Pennsylvania's distinct seasons directly impact air duct cleanliness. During spring and fall, when heating and cooling systems cycle frequently to handle temperature shifts, indoor air quality is paramount. The humid summers can also contribute to mold and mildew growth within ductwork if not properly managed. Air duct cleaning service involves the mechanical removal of dust, dirt, and other contaminants from your HVAC system's air ducts. This process uses specialized tools and equipment to dislodge and extract debris. The goal is to improve the air you breathe inside your home, especially in areas like Erie where seasonal air quality concerns can arise.
